Pays/Territoire Bulgarie Type du document Législation Date 1992 (1999) Source FAO, FAOLEX Sujet Agriculture et développement rural Mot clé Développement agricole Entité non-gouvernementale Commerce/industrie/sociétés Aire géographique Mer Noire, Europe de l'Est, Europe, Europe et Asie Centrale, Pays de l'Union Européenne Résumé This Act establishes the terms and procedures under which state-owned enterprises shall be transformed into single-person companies and shall become subject to privatization. Transformation of state-owned enterprises means the division of the equity provided by the state into shares or interests under the provisions of the Commercial Code. Privatization shall be carried out on the basis of programmes approved by the Council of Ministers, prepared by procedure established by the Council. The Council of Ministers shall submit the Programme to the National Assembly not later than 31 October of the previous year, which shall debate it and enact it prior to the adoption of the State Budget Bill. The decision to privatise a state-owned or a municipal enterprise shall be taken by authorities specified in section 3. A Privatization Agency is here established as a government agency under the Council of Ministers for the purpose of organising and supervising the privatization of state-owned enterprises, and for the purpose of carrying out such privatization where provided by this Act.
